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8071014842 43905 82895
41920289461 767894 8716322687
41920289461 767894 8716322687
35 700854292 9033 77 36
All about undefined
Interested in learning more?
41920289461 767894 8716322687
35 700854292 9033 77 36
See more
0216852 26880
42878936587 6760 86270347
See more
1999517469 410432
816206670 82 481 847 62
See more